 Forex quotes include a "bid" and "ask“. The “bid” is the price at which a market maker is willing
to buy (clients sell) while the “ask” is where the market maker will sell (clients buy) the
currency pair.

How to work with Candle Sticks
 The rectangular part of the candlestick line is called the Real Body. The thin vertical lines above
and below the body are called Shadows. They show lows and highs within a specified period of
time. Depending the closing and opening prices the real body can white (or green) representing
price appreciation, or Black (or red) representing price depreciation.

How to Change Chart Period
 The period displayed in one bar or candle. For example, if you create a 15 minute bar chart, then
each bar will have the price data for the relevant 15 minutes. In MetaTrader 4 the following time
periods can be used: 1, 5, 15, 30 minutes (M1, M5, M15, M30 respectively), 1 hour (H1), 4 hours
(H4), 1 day (D1), 1 week (W1) and 1 month (MN).

How to Open/Close Positions
 Right click on the Market Watch or Main Menu window and then select “New Order”


The “New Order” Window
 In the “Order” Window, Choose either “Buy” if you think the currency will appreciate or “Sell” if
you think the currency will depreciate


Click “OK”

The “Terminal Window”
 The trade will appear under the “Trade” tab in the Terminal window on the bottom of the
Platform.

How to Modify Orders
 In the Terminal Window, right click on the your open position and select “Modify or Delete
Order”.

How to Add Stop-Loss/Take Profit
 In the “Modify Order” window, select the your desired Stop Loss/Take Profit levels. In this case,
I selected 50 points (pips).

 Next, Click on one or both of the desired “Copy As” button to make the “Modify” button appear.
Once it does, click on it to activate.

 Click “OK” to confirm.

The Terminal Window
 After you execute the Stop Loss/Take Profit orders, they will appear in the Terminal window
(highlighted in green).
 The order will be executed if at least one quote in the quotes flow reaches the order level.

How to Execute Pending Orders
 In the “New Order” window, under Type, select “Pending Order”.

 Next, select the type of command, price as well as expiry time and date. To finish, click on the
“Place” button.

 Press “OK” to confirm.

 Once the Place order button is pressed, the instruction is sent directly to the software's Trading
Desk. Once the software confirms the order, it appears in the "Trade" tab of the "Terminal"
window.
